Output 54b6623337c5da786a145c5430108bddd828580dd569e0b44b02773f9838c99a:0

value
70256896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3001699e1cf38d8fe37eb041b07369b50e4eed2a OP_EQUAL
address
MCGzMnVB1fLFX12JU6aB1TRYjpeqJYacc9
transaction
54b6623337c5da786a145c5430108bddd828580dd569e0b44b02773f9838c99a
spent
true